Warning!
CPU Heatsink Installation Procedures (For Supermicro SuperServer 2U Systems)
Due to the fact that adequate air flow and proper thermal control are very critical in maintaining 2U system's stability and performance,
it is imperative that the proper installation procedures listed below be followed in order to maximize system performance. This is
especially critical for 2U dual Xeon processor server solutions.
1) Only those CPU heatsinks that are provided by Supermicro should be used.
2) Apply a small amount of silicon compound on the CPU's die.
3) Place the CPU heatsink on top of the CPU.
4) Attach the heatsink clips to the heatsink retention pieces, one on each side of the heatsink as shown in the diagram at right.
5) The three tabs on each heatsink retention pieces should complete protrude though the corresponding holes on the heatsink clips
Note: Please note that special, new silver heatsin retention clips must be used with all Xeon 533MHz FSB (front side bus) 604-pin
processors. These new retention clips have "604P" clearly marked on them. Using the old clips will not keep the proper amount of pressure
applied and may cause the processor to overheat. You should not use these new retention clips with 400MHz FSB processors (even if the
CPU socket is 604-pin) as they will too tight and damage the CPU socket.
X5DLR-8G2 Quick Reference
J35 Spread Spectrum Open (Disabled)
JA4 SCSI Enable/Disable Pins 1-2 (Enabled)
JBT1 CMOS Clear Pad
JP2 Speaker Enable/Disable Close (Enabled)
JP3 Watch Dog Pins 2-3 (NMI)
JP12 System Bus Speed Pins 1-2 (Auto)
JP48 Chassis/Overheat Fan Select Open (Overheat)
JP56 VGA Enable/Disable Pins 1-2 (Enabled)
JP58 Fan Detection Select Open (CPU Fan)
JPA1/A2 SCSI Channel A/B Termination Open (Terminated)
